Ingredients
For the Shredded Tofu
- 200 g firm tofu, pressed and shredded
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 teaspoon chipotle chili powder
- ½ teaspoon smoked paprika
- ½ teaspoon cumin
- Salt and pepper to taste
For the Nachos
- 1 bag tortilla chips
- 1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or Mexican blend)
- ½ cup black beans (cooked or canned, drained)
- ½ cup corn kernels
- ½ cup diced tomatoes
- ¼ cup sliced jalapeños
- ¼ cup chopped red onion
- ¼ cup chopped cilantro
For Serving
- Sour cream and guacamole, for serving
- Lime wedges, for garnish
How to Make Shredded Tofu Chipotle Nachos
Step 1: Cook the Tofu
-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at.
- Add shredded tofu along with chipotle powder, smoked paprika, cumin, salt, and pepper.
- Cook for 5–7 minutes until browned and crispy.
Step 2: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
Step 3: Assemble the Nachos
- On a baking sheet, spread tortilla chips evenly.
- Top with cooked shredded tofu, shredded cheese, black beans, corn, diced tomatoes, sliced jalapeños, and chopped red onion.
Step 4: Bake Until Cheesy
Bake in the preheated oven for 10–12 minutes or until cheese is melted and bubbly.
Step 5: Garnish
Remove from oven and sprinkle with chopped cilantro.
Step 6: Serve Warm
Serve warm with sour cream, guacamole on the side, and lime wedges for an extra zing!

How to Perfect Shredded Tofu Chipotle Nachos
To make your Shredded Tofu Chipotle Nachos truly exceptional, consider these helpful tips. They will ensure that every bite is packed with flavor and texture.
- Use Firm Tofu: This type holds its shape better when shredded and cooked, providing a satisfying texture.
- Press Tofu Properly: Removing excess moisture allows the tofu to crisp up nicely when cooked.
- Mix Spices Well: Ensure the chipotle chili powder, smoked paprika, and cumin are evenly distributed for consistent flavor.
- Layer Ingredients Carefully: Start with chips at the bottom, then add toppings evenly to prevent sogginess.
- Watch Baking Time Closely: Keep an eye on your nachos while baking to avoid overcooking; melted cheese should be bubbly but not burnt.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Making Shredded Tofu Chipotle Nachos can be a fun experience, but there are common pitfalls that can affect the final dish. Here are some mistakes to avoid.
- Overcooking the Tofu: Cooking the tofu for too long can make it dry and tough. Aim for a nice golden-brown color in just 5-7 minutes.
- Skipping Seasoning: Not seasoning your tofu properly can lead to bland nachos. Use chipotle powder, cumin, and smoked paprika for flavor.
- Using Old Tortilla Chips: Stale chips will ruin the texture of your dish. Always check the expiration date on your chips before using them.
- Neglecting Fresh Ingredients: Fresh toppings like tomatoes and cilantro enhance flavor and nutrition. Don’t forget to add these vibrant ingredients.
- Crowding the Baking Sheet: Overloading your baking sheet can prevent even cooking. Spread your nachos out so everything gets nicely melted and crispy.
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
- Keep toppings separate to maintain crunchiness.
Freezing Shredded Tofu Chipotle Nachos
- Freeze assembled nachos without toppings for up to 2 months.
- Wrap tightly in plastic wrap followed by aluminum foil.
Reheating Shredded Tofu Chipotle Nachos
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and bake for about 10 minutes until heated through.
- Microwave: Heat on medium power for 1-2 minutes, checking frequently.
- Stovetop: Place in a skillet over medium heat, cover, and cook until warmed.
Frequently Asked Questions
Here are some common questions about making Shredded Tofu Chipotle Nachos.
Can I use different types of cheese?
Yes! You can substitute with any cheese you prefer, or use a vegan alternative if you’re aiming for a fully plant-based option.
What if I don’t have chipotle chili powder?
You can use regular chili powder as an alternative, but consider adding a dash of smoked paprika to mimic that smoky flavor.
Are Shredded Tofu Chipotle Nachos gluten-free?
If you choose gluten-free tortilla chips, this recipe can be made gluten-free. Always check labels on products.
How spicy are these nachos?
The spice level depends on how much chipotle chili powder you use. You can adjust it according to your preference.
Can I customize the toppings?
Absolutely! Feel free to add or swap any toppings like avocado, olives, or different beans based on what you enjoy!
